How to Choose the Right Best Car Battery for Toyota Corolla
Capacity and size
Selecting the correct capacity and size for a Toyota Corolla battery involves knowing the precise group size compatible with the model, commonly Group 35 or 24F, ensuring a proper fit within the battery tray to prevent movement or damage. Amp hour ratings should align with your driving frequency and electrical demands; higher Ah values deliver longer power for accessories and infrequent drivers, while average to lower Ah suits daily commuters. Physical dimensions must be verified against the Corolla’s specifications, as a snug and secure installation prevents vibration-related wear.
For most drivers, a Group 35 battery with an amp hour rating between 40 and 50 Ah balances performance and fit seamlessly.
Power and cold cranking amps cca
High cold cranking amps (CCA) are crucial for dependable starting power, especially in cold weather conditions where robust initial voltage overcomes engine resistance. A CCA rating above 550 amps is ideal for Toyota Corollas to guarantee smooth startups in low temperatures without straining the battery. Reserve capacity, which measures how long a battery can sustain power if the alternator fails, should be at least 90 minutes to provide sufficient durability when under electrical load.
These power specifications directly impact the Corolla’s ignition reliability and accessory support, so choosing a battery with strong CCA and reserve capacity optimizes engine performance under varied working conditions.
Durability and material quality
Opting for an Absorbent Glass Mat (AGM) battery instead of a traditional flooded lead-acid type delivers superior durability and improved resistance to vibration, which is beneficial in a compact sedan like the Corolla. AGM batteries also reduce acid spillage risk and promote better corrosion resistance on terminals, preserving connection quality. The casing material should be robust and leak-proof to withstand heat and rough road conditions without damage.
Under standard daily use, AGM batteries tend to last around five to seven years, outliving many flooded options, making them the preferred choice for drivers wanting longevity combined with reliable performance.
Temperature performance and reliability
Batteries for Toyota Corolla must maintain performance amid temperature extremes, and those with enhanced temperature-resistant features demonstrate superior reliability. AGM batteries excel at high temperatures by minimizing water loss and perform reliably in cold climates by retaining charge capacity better than flooded types. Look for sealed designs and materials engineered to reduce thermal degradation, as temperature directly affects battery lifespan by accelerating wear when exposed to heat or weakening capacity in freezing conditions.
For users in areas with unpredictable or harsh weather, an AGM battery with a sealed, heat- and cold-tolerant construction offers the most dependable performance and lasting durability.

Frequently Asked Questions
What Size Car Battery Does A Toyota Corolla Need?
A Toyota Corolla typically requires a Group 35 or 51R size battery, which fits its tray and terminal layout. Choosing the correct size is crucial for a secure fit and proper connection to ensure reliable performance.
Why Is Cold Cranking Amps (Cca) Important For Toyota Corolla Batteries?
Cold Cranking Amps (CCA) indicate the battery’s ability to start an engine in cold temperatures, which is vital for Toyota Corolla owners in colder climates. A battery with adequate CCA ensures your Corolla starts smoothly even in harsh weather conditions.
What Are The Advantages Of Agm Batteries For A Toyota Corolla?
AGM batteries offer enhanced durability, better resistance to vibration, and spill-proof design, making them ideal for Toyota Corolla drivers seeking longevity and reliability. They also perform well under extreme temperature variations compared to traditional flooded batteries.
How Does Temperature Affect The Performance Of Car Batteries In A Toyota Corolla?
Temperature significantly impacts battery efficiency; cold can reduce starting power while heat may shorten battery lifespan. Toyota Corolla owners should choose batteries designed to tolerate temperature extremes for consistent reliability.
